Lili Taylor has been cast as Mags in Lionsgate’s “The Hunger Games: Sunrise on the Reaping,” an adaptation of the bestselling book by Suzanne Collins. She joins previously announced cast members Joseph Zada as Haymitch Abernathy, Whitney Peak as Lenore Dove Baird, Mckenna Grace as Maysilee Donner, Jesse Plemons as Plutarch Heavensbee, Maya Hawke as Wiress and Kelvin Harrison Jr. as Beetee.
Mags, previously portrayed by Lynn Cohen in “Catching Fire,” is a former Hunger Games champion-turned-District 12 mentor.
Taylor is a three-time Emmy nominee who will next be seen in the second season of Marvel’s “Daredevil: Born Again” as well as Netflix’s “Fear Street: Prom Queen.” She can also be seen starring in the mystery drama “Outer Range” on Amazon. In the literary space, this spring, Taylor released her debut book “Turning to Birds,” a love letter to birding and the art of seeking peace in unexpected places.
The film adaptation of “The Hunger Games: Sunrise on the Reaping” will be released on Nov. 20, 2026. Francis Lawrence will direct from a screenplay adaptation by Billy Ray. Color Force’s Nina Jacobson and Brad Simpson will produce. Cameron MacConomy will executive produce.
Published on March 18, “Sunrise on the Reaping” revisits the world of Panem twenty-four years before the events of “The Hunger Games,” starting on the morning of the reaping of the Fiftieth Hunger Games, also known as the Second Quarter Quell.
“Sunrise on the Reaping” sold 1.5 million copies in its first week on sale in the U.S., U.K., Ireland, Canada, Australia and New Zealand. The 1.2 million copies sold in the U.S. are twice the first week sales of “The Ballad of Songbirds and Snakes” and three times the first week sales of “Mockingjay.” The five films in the franchise have taken in over $3.3 billion at the box office.
Meredith Wieck and Scott O’Brien are overseeing the project for Lionsgate. Robert Melnik negotiated the deal for the studio.
